Retail Associates - Las Vegas, NV

Hobby Lobby Stores, Inc. is a leading arts and crafts retailer known for its extensive selection of products that inspire creativity and innovation. Founded in 1972, Hobby Lobby has grown to become one of the most recognized names in the retail craft industry across the United States. With a commitment to providing high-quality merchandise alongside excellent customer service, the company has established a broad footprint with hundreds of stores nationwide. Hobby Lobby prides itself on fostering a positive and dynamic work environment that encourages personal growth and achievement while delivering an exceptional shopping experience for its customers. Located in Las Vegas, Nevada, Hobby Lobby is currently seeking energetic and enthusiastic part-time Retail Associates to join its vibrant team at the 2251 N. Rainbow Blvd location. This role offers an excellent opportunity for individuals who are passionate about arts and crafts and eager to contribute to a stimulating work culture. Retail Associates at Hobby Lobby play a crucial role in maintaining the store's standard of excellence by assisting customers with product selections, ensuring inventory is well-stocked and organized, and providing knowledgeable support across various departments including Art, Crafts, Custom Frames, Fabrics, Floral, and Hobbies. This position offers part-time employment with competitive hourly wages starting between $15.75 and $16.75. Store hours are Monday through Saturday, from 9 am to 8 pm, with the store closed on Sundays, providing associates with a balanced work schedule. For those interested in long-term career growth, Hobby Lobby offers various full-time benefits for those who transition into or are hired for full-time roles. These benefits include competitive wages, medical, dental and prescription plans, a 401(k) retirement program with company match, paid vacation, sick/personal pay, employee discounts, life insurance, long-term disability insurance, flexible spending plans, and holiday pay.
